Species: The type of the parrot significantly impacts its rate. Uncommon types tend to be more costly, while common types like budgies and cockatiels are usually more affordable.

Age: Young parrots, especially those that are hand-fed, frequently command greater prices compared to older birds. Juveniles are usually simpler to train and bond with.

Color Mutations: Certain color variations or mutations can greatly increase the cost. For example, a typical blue parakeet may be priced lower than an uncommon opaline or lutino variety.

Breeder vs. Pet Store: Purchasing a parrot from a credible breeder usually comes at a higher rate than purchasing from a pet store, however breeders frequently provide much better health warranties and background on the bird's family tree.

Tameness: Birds that are hand-tamed or trained to communicate with individuals will be more costly than those that are not. Tame birds are typically more social and can be more enjoyable buddies.

Extra Costs of Parrot Ownership
In addition to the preliminary cost of buying a parrot, brand-new owners need to understand continuous expenditures associated with parrot care. Below is a breakdown of prospective expenses connected with parrot ownership:

A parrot's diet mainly consists of pellets, seeds, fruits, and veggies. The diet plan varies by species, but owners must spending plan ₤ 200 to ₤ 500 each year for top quality food.
Cage and Equipment
The preliminary cost of a sufficient cage and essential devices (perches, toys, food and water dishes) can range from ₤ 150 to ₤ 500, depending on the size and quality. Many owners also buy extra toys and sets down to keep their birds promoted.
Veterinary Care
Regular veterinary care is necessary for all pet birds. Annual check-ups, vaccinations, and emergency situation care can amount to ₤ 100 to ₤ 300, depending upon the bird's health and the services required.
Toys and Enrichment
Parrots are smart and curious animals that need mental stimulation. A spending plan of ₤ 50 to ₤ 200 annual for toys and other enrichment activities can avoid monotony and encourage overall well-being.
Insurance coverage
While not necessary, some owners select animal insurance to cover unforeseen veterinary costs, which can range from ₤ 200 to ₤ 500 yearly.
Miscellaneous Expenses
Grooming, periodic boarding, and other various costs may likewise occur, costing an extra ₤ 50 to ₤ 100 a year.
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)1. What is the most affordable parrot to buy?
Budgerigars (budgies) are typically the most budget-friendly parrots, with costs ranging from ₤ 15 to ₤ 100.
2. Are parrots costly to take care of?
Yes, owning a parrot can be costly due to their food, real estate, veterinary care, and enrichment needs.
3. The length of time do parrots live?
Parrot lifespans differ by species; smaller parrots like budgies might live 5 to 10 years, while larger types like macaws can live 30 to 50 years.
4. Can I discover totally free or affordable parrots?
Some individuals might rehome parrots for various reasons. Regional shelters or rescue groups might also use lower-cost adoption costs.
5. What should I think about before purchasing a parrot?
Before buying a parrot, consider its lifespan, care requirements, social needs, and whether you have the time and resources to supply an ideal environment.
